The python-can library provides controller area network support for Python, providing common abstractions to different hardware devices, and a suite of utilities for sending and receiving messages on a can bus.
python-can runs any where Python runs; from high powered computers with commercial can to usb devices right down to low powered devices running linux such as a BeagleBone or RaspberryPi.
More concretely, some example uses of the library:
- Passively logging what occurs on a can bus. For example monitoring a commercial vehicle using its OBD-II port.
- Testing of hardware that interacts via can. Modules found in modern cars, motocycles, boats, and even wheelchairs have had components tested from Python using this library.
- Prototyping new hardware modules or software algorithms in-the-loop. Easily interact with an existing bus.
- Creating virtual modules to prototype can bus communication.
